Fraction Operations and Ratios Numbers, in all their forms, are important in our everyday lives. Unit 2 focuses on the uses of and ratios. The unit begins with a review of factors and multiples. Students learn to find the greatest common factors and least common multiples for pairs of numbers, and they use these concepts to solve real-world and mathematical problems. Students revisit and apply multiplication. Many of the fractions your child will work with (halves, thirds, fourths, sixths, eighths, tenths, twelfths, and 2 sixteenths) are common in everyday situations. Students review fraction in the context of real-world and mathematical problems. They are encouraged to use pictures and to estimate in order to make sense of the problems, and they use a common-denominator algorithm to divide fractions. The emphasis of the fraction-division lessons is on understanding the concept of fraction division and investigating when and how to use fraction division. Finally, students work with reciprocals and solve fraction-division problems using the U.S. traditional algorithm (multiplying the dividend of the division problem by the reciprocal of the ). The second half of Unit 2 is devoted to exploring ratios. Ratios use division to compare quantities. Rates, which are ratios that compare quantities with different units, constitute part of this exploration. In this unit, your child uses ratio representations and ratio notation in many forms to make a variety of comparisons. For example, if 5 eggs out of a dozen are brown and the rest are white, then the ratio of brown eggs to white eggs is 5 : 7 (or 5 to 7), and the ratio of brown eggs 5 _ to the total number of eggs is 5 : 12 (or 5 out of 12, or 12 ). Students make and use ratio/ tables to solve real-world and mathematical problems, including measurement-conversion problems. Please keep this Family Letter for reference as your child works through Unit 2.

Do-Anytime Activities 1. Help your child look for examples of fractions in advertisements, brochures, newspapers, magazines, recipes, and other sources. Discuss how the examples you found use fractions. 2. Help your child practice using ratios by comparing sports teams’ records. For example, compare wins to losses (such as 15 to 5) or wins to games played (15 out of 20). 3. Look for enlarged or reduced images of objects. For example, a cereal box may display a picture of the cereal that is two times its actual size, or a science magazine may show pictures of insects or bacteria that have been enlarged several hundred times their actual size. Have your child explain to you what the size-change factor means.
